<p>METHOD FOR THE DETERMINATION OF ANTIGENS AND ANTIBODIES USING SITE-DEACTIVATING MEDIA An improved immunoassay sample determination process for determining the presence of a component of an antigen-antibody reaction in a sample is disclosed which substantially eliminates non-specific interactions between the sample and the reaction vessel wall surfaces during the antigen-antibody reaction, to thereby greatly increase the accuracy of the process. In practice, a site-deactivating medium such as an animalor vegetable-derived total biological fluid or extract (e.g., plasma or gelatin) is covalently bound to the vessel wall surfaces for deactivation purposes. In preferred forms the process is solid-state, wherein one of the components of the antigen-antibody reaction is coupled covalently to the coating medium, and a reaction mixture fraction including the sample being determined and the other component which has been labeled, for instance by means of a colorimetrically active enzyme.
